The ILIFEV3s Pro Robot Vacuum Cleaner is a cutting-edge, automatic cleaning solution designed for pet owners. With its tangle-free suction, it effectively picks up pet hair and debris on various surfaces, including hardwood and low pile carpets. Featuring a slim design, it can easily navigate under furniture, while its smart scheduling and self-charging capabilities ensure a hassle-free cleaning experience. Equipped with safety sensors, this vacuum prevents falls and collisions, making it a reliable addition to any home.

As with most things, reviews have to be read with the lens of price, and in the case of this vacuum I think you also need to have proper expectations based on the needs of the space you intend to use it in. If you are looking for a hard traffic area with carpet and pets you are better off saving up your pennies for a less entry level machine. If I had bought this expecting to use in in the first space described below I would be sudo-disappointed. That said, for the price and space that I am using it in I love it and wish I could give it more of a 4.5 than 4 star.I first ran this vac on our main floor which has lots of obstacles and rooms that are not an open floor plan. This area also has the most traffic in the house, and therefore is in frequent need of cleaning. We have 2 dogs and one cat and this floor of the house is where they spend most of their time. Given that this is bump navigation it is not the most ideal vac for the space, given the room separation, as it is not guaranteed to work its way into all the spaces you may want without physically moving the machine from room to room by hand. This area also poses a problem in debris bin capacity. This space is a mix of tile and carpet. The performance on carpet is mediocre but is worked great on the tile. These are all things I knew going in so I am not disappointed.I then moved the machine to it's intended home which is our open floor plan basement that is a mix of LVT and linoleum. This space is much more limited it terms of obstacles and traffic. For this area I love the vacuum. Sure it may not cover every square inch with each cleaning but its doesn't really have to. The lower traffic also make debris bin space much less of an issue and I only have to empty it one or two times a week. The hair collection off of hard surface is good, and if picks up a surprising amount of fine dust. For the $100 I payed on Black Friday I couldn't be happier given the space it is being used in.
